24小时热门版块排行榜    

CyRhmU.jpeg
查看: 685  |  回复: 10
当前主题已经存档。
【有奖交流】积极回复本帖子,参与交流,就有机会分得作者 nkwz 的 46 个金币 ,回帖就立即获得 1 个金币,每人有 1 次机会
当前只显示满足指定条件的回帖,点击这里查看本话题的所有回帖

nkwz

木虫 (小有名气)

[交流] 【求助】intel fotran 2问已有3人参与

系统是 64bit XP
visual studio 2005 + intel fortran 11.1.038

问题1:利用VS 编写fortran 代码,一定要建立Project么?不能像compaq visual fortran
            那样直接写代码,然后编译,运行?

问题2:VS好像调用的intel编译器是32位的,怎么指定调用64位的intel编译器呢?

thx~
回复此楼
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

holmescn

金虫 (正式写手)

★ ★
nkwz(金币+1): 2010-04-11 10:22
wangen994(金币+2):活动期间额外奖励 2010-04-11 10:55
问题1:VS是一种IDE,他除了可以帮你编辑代码以外,还帮你管理项目,称作软件生命周期管理。包括软件(程序)的设计,编码,调试,发布等一系列的工序的完整解决方案。而这一整套解决方案的基础就是Project。所以,Project是必须创建的,但这不是为了给你找麻烦,而是方便你对整个项目的管理。要善加利用。

问题2:首先,你需要VS是x64的,ifort是x64的。然后再解决方案的属性里,找到Fortran类,找找processor这个选项。改之。

PS:问题2的解决方法不一定准确,因为很久不用VS和WIN算数了。如未能解决,请留言。
5楼2010-04-11 09:36:22
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
查看全部 11 个回答

tjyl

金虫 (正式写手)

★ ★ ★ ★
nkwz(金币+1):谢谢参与
余泽成(金币+1):谢谢参与应助! 2010-04-10 23:38
wangen994(金币+2):活动期间额外奖励 2010-04-11 10:55
看大家为了装个编译器就这么麻烦。
还是用这个吧
ftp://ftp.equation.com/gcc/gcc-4.5-20100408-64.exe
用任意一个编辑器,把代码写好,修改后缀名为.f90(c的话就.c)
然后  从“运行”里输入cmd, 切换到你工作目录,然后 gfortran xxx.f90
然后 ./a.exe就行了。
2楼2010-04-10 21:56:55
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

holmescn

金虫 (正式写手)


nkwz(金币+1):谢谢参与
引用回帖:
Originally posted by tjyl at 2010-04-10 21:56:55:
看大家为了装个编译器就这么麻烦。
还是用这个吧
ftp://ftp.equation.com/gcc/gcc-4.5-20100408-64.exe
用任意一个编辑器,把代码写好,修改后缀名为.f90(c的话就.c)
然后  从“运行”里输入cmd,  ...

用C的话,要加上-ffast-math选项哦。
3楼2010-04-11 09:05:53
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

tjyl

金虫 (正式写手)

这样的优化选项可以不加的。
引用回帖:
Originally posted by holmescn at 2010-04-11 09:05:53:


用C的话,要加上-ffast-math选项哦。

4楼2010-04-11 09:24:19
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
提示: 如果您在30分钟内回复过其他散金贴,则可能无法领取此贴金币
普通表情 高级回复(可上传附件)
信息提示
请填处理意见